@ladychr0nic If you haven't already (I might've missed it), get a weight averaging app, like Libra on android or Happy Scale on apple products. It's easier to take daily weighing in stride when you know your trend is still good. @seltzer_lover beat me to this advice I see. Great minds.

goal06082021 wrote: Β»Bodies gonna body how bodies do. The number on the scale is just a description of your relationship with gravity in that moment, that's all. When was the last time you went #2, when was your last period, how much sodium have you had lately, did you ramp things up in the gym recently, is Mercury in Gatorade or something, etc.

I made some delicious tomato soup for lunch, from almost-scratch (I started with canned whole tomatoes - if they were in season rn I would have gotten fresh). I also made a chocolate-and-cherry baked oatmeal for breakfast next week that I'm really looking forward to, and next week's lunch came together MUCH more easily than the stir-fry, LMAO. It's a warm roasted vegetable pasta salad with turkey kielbasa - I just cut up my kielbasa and veggies (brussels sprouts and mushrooms; there's also squash but I bought that frozen and already cubed, and cherry tomatoes but those I left whole), tossed the veg with some olive oil and then stuck it all in the oven for about half an hour, then mixed that up with some tricolor rotini and dressed the whole thing with a splash of white balsamic vinegar.8 -
